### Changelog — Lanternbird firmware channel

Heads up: we flipped the default update channel for Pelt-series devices from `weekly` to `staged`. Rollouts now trickle out over 48 hours instead of hitting the whole fleet at once, so fewer 3am pages. Nothing else moved. The new channel defaults are listed below.

config for yajep-tafof:
[rusath]
team = julmir
access_code = ac_fe37fd
host = rusath.novactech.test
port = 8000
owner = pelmir.weneth
peer = oliwyn.olvarqdyn.internal

Telemetry volume from the Harrowgate fleet is up 40% quarter over quarter. Storage costs tracking ahead of budget. Proposal: enable zstd compression on batched payloads at the collector edge before they hit the Quillon ingest tier. Bench runs show ~72% size reduction at acceptable CPU cost. Decompression overhead downstream is negligible. Rollout gated behind a flag; canary on two shards first. Need sign-off at sync. Proposed batching and compression constants for the canary are as follows:

tuning table, yajog-yahof:
BUDGETS = {
    "lamvan": 303,
    "wenox": 460,
    "fenvan": 525,
}

= Building Access: Data-Centre Cage Visits =

Quick guide for facilities staff escorting vendors to the cage at the Norwell site. Visits must be booked a day ahead and escorted at all times — no exceptions, even for the chatty cooling techs. Sign the logbook inside the anteroom on the way in and out. The cage door uses the code below.

staff pass of kagup-fajog = bdg-QCHVQW-99665837

// Notes for the weekly eng sync re: Gallerywhisper, our museum audio-guide app.
// This constant sets the prefetch radius for exhibit audio clips. At the
// Hollen Pavilion pilot we learned visitors walk faster than our original
// estimate, so clips were buffering mid-stride. Bumping this to three rooms
// ahead fixed it, at a modest bandwidth cost. Don't lower it without testing
// on the slow gallery wifi first — seriously, it's painful. The trace token
// from the pilot build that validated this number is appended just below.

trace token, kahap-bagaf: htk4_8458